Respected mufti sahab, last sunday my grand mother expired in toilet. She finished her tasbihat then went to toilet. When she didn’t domes out for long half an hour, when we checked we found her death. she was finished the need and weared the payzama. She was about 82. she was blind and she couldn’t walk also. she was seating at one place since about 15 yeares. she was not praying namaz, because she was not able to purify her self properly. Please can you comment by hadith and quran as she expired in toilet, which is not pure, what will happen to her hereafter. jazakallah khair

Answer

Rasulullah Sallallahu Aalaayhi wa Sallam said : Do not speak ill about the
deceased (Bukhari).In view of the above mentioned Hadith, it is not
appropriate for us to comment on the condition of your grandmothers death.
The reality of her condition is best known by Allah Ta’ala.

It is your duty to make dua for her salvation in the Qabr (grave) and the
hereafter.

and Allah Ta’ala Knows Best
